Logo (1969)
Visuals: In a room is the NZBC logo, which consists of an abstract TV shape with four circles with "N", "Z", "B", and "C" inside each circle. Next to the text is "Wellington".
Technique: A still, printed image.
Audio: Some loud sirens noises.
Availability: Seen on The Songs They Sang.
